Serving 674 students in grades 6-8, Parrish Middle School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Oregon for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 17% (which is lower than the Oregon state average of 31%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 28% (which is lower than the Oregon state average of 44%).
The student:teacher ratio of 20:1 is higher than the Oregon state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 72%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Oregon state average of 42% (majority Hispanic).

What is the racial composition of the student body?
59% of Parrish Middle School students are Hispanic, 28% of students are White, 7% of students are Two or more races, 3% of students are Black, 2% of students are Hawaiian, and 1% of students are Asian.
